摘 要:针对皇竹草种植排种装置漏种卡种,排种性能不稳定,适宜预切种茎类作物排种装置缺乏等问题,基于柔性输送带与胶辊组合充种清种的技术思路,设计一种柔性输送带-胶辊组合式皇竹草种茎排序输送排种装置。设计的装置实现了皇竹草种茎有序充种、高效清种和精量排种。通过理论分析确定影响皇竹草有效充种的关键结构参数为输送带倾斜角(β)、充种胶辊-清种胶辊间距(B)。采用离散元仿真方法,构建输送带-胶辊组合充种、清种的离散元仿真模型,优选得出β、B最优参数组合为60°、80 mm。试验表明:充种合格率和漏播率分别为95.9%和4.1%,与仿真结果的相对误差为0.8%,表明仿真模型可准确模拟皇竹草预切种茎排序输送排种过程。To solve the problems of uneven seeding,seed jamming and unstable seeding performance in planting arrangement device for Pennisetum hydridum,and the lack of suitable pre-cut seedling sowing devices,a flexible conveyor belt and rubber roller combination seeding and seed cleaning device was designed based on the technical idea of seeding and seed cleaning.The device could orderly fill the Pennisetum hydridum seedlings with seeds,efficiently clean seeds and precision seed.The key structural parameters affecting the effective seeding of Pennisetum hydridum were determined by theoretical analysis,which was the inclination angle of the conveyor belt(β)and the distance between the seeding rubber roller and the cleaning rubber roller(B).The discrete element method was used to build a discrete element simulation model of the conveyor belt and rubber roller combination seeding and seed cleaning,and the optimal parameter combination ofβand B was selected as 60°and 80 mm.The bench test results showed that the seeding qualification rate and seeding failure rate were 95.9%and 4.1%,respectively,with a relative errorr of 0.8%between simulation results and actual results,which indicated that the simulation model could accurately simulate the Pennisetum hydridum pre-cut seedling sorting and seeding process.
